KO Hedge Fund Activity: Q1 2023 in Review

2,872 of the 6,276 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in Coca-Cola (KO) for Q1 2023, worth a combined $189B — down 3.1% from $195B a quarter earlier.

Buyers outnumbered sellers: 161 funds opened new KO positions and 103 closed out — a net gain of 58 holders — while 1,129 added to existing stakes and 1,128 trimmed.

The largest buyer was BLS Capital Fondsmaeglerselskab, opening a new position worth an estimated $182M. The largest seller was Fidelity Investments, cutting an estimated $530M.
